EL PASO, Texas — The mayor of a Texas border metropolis declared a state of emergency Saturday over issues about the neighborhood’s means to deal with an anticipated inflow of migrants throughout the Southern border.
El Paso Mayor Oscar Leeser issued the state of emergency declaration to permit the metropolis on the U.S. border with Mexico to faucet into extra sources which are anticipated to turn out to be crucial after Title 42 expulsions finish on Dec. 21, the El Paso Times reported.
Leeser had beforehand resisted issuing an emergency declaration, however stated he was moved to motion by the sight of folks on downtown streets with temperatures dipping beneath freezing, the Times reported.
“That’s not the way we want to treat people,” Leeser stated throughout a news convention Saturday night.
A ruling Friday by the D.C. Circuit Court of Appeals means restrictions which have prevented lots of of hundreds of migrants from searching for asylum in the U.S. lately are nonetheless set to be lifted Wednesday, until additional appeals are filed.
Leeser added that the enhance could be “incredible” after Wednesday, when each day apprehensions and road releases may attain as much as 6,000 per day, the Times reported.
El Paso Deputy City Manager Mario D’Agostino stated the state emergency of declaration would give the metropolis higher flexibility in working bigger sheltering operations and offering extra transportation for asylum seekers.
